Shanghai on the Metro Spies, Intrigue, and the French Between the Wars.
Secret agents, gun runners, White Russians, and con men--they all play a part in Michael B. Miller's strikingly original study of interwar France. Based on extensive research in security files and a mass of printed sources, Shanghai on the Métro shows how a distinctive milieu of spies and spy...
